Catherine Williams Obituary

Obituary published on Legacy.com by Bostick-Tompkins Funeral Home - Columbia on Dec. 12, 2025.
Catherine Watkins Williams, affectionately known as "Cathy," was born on November 27, 1955, in Columbia, South Carolina, the beloved daughter of the late James "Bunny" Watkins and Mae Frances "BayBay" Watkins. She entered her heavenly home on Saturday, December 6, 2025, in Columbia, South Carolina.

Cathy received her formal education in the Richland County School District and later graduated from Keenan High School in 1973. With a servant's heart, she dedicated 43 years of her life working as a Dietician at Baptist Hospital. There, she had the blessing of serving alongside her beloved mother and sister, creating memories and bonds that would last a lifetime.

Catherine was united in marriage to the late Marion Williams, with whom she shared many years of companionship and devotion. She was known for her signature red lipstick, her love of cooking, and barbeque (grilling and eating), and she was a Carolina Gamecocks Football and Girls Basketball SUPER FAN.

She was preceded in death by not only her husband and parents, but also by her brothers, James "Jimmy" Watkins, Jr., Michael Watkins, and Jerry Lee Watkins; and her sister, Sherrie Davis.

She leaves to cherish her beautiful memories her children, Brian Watkins, Bobby Alexander, Kelly Alexander, Ashley Alexander, and her bonus daughter, Monica Williams. Her legacy continues through her grandchildren, Brian Hayes, Brion Hayes, Bryonna Watkins, Joshua McGraw, Jaylon Alexander, Jamere Alexander, Jahaun Alexander, Malia Alexander, Miracle Leverette; and bonus grandchildren, Desmind Williams and Destiny Williams; as well as great-grandchildren who will grow up hearing stories of her strength. She is also survived by her loving aunt, Hazel Scott, and a host of nieces, nephews, cousins, extended relatives, and dear friends who thank God for the blessing of her life.

Catherine's life was a testimony of love, resilience, and faith. Though she is no longer with us in earthly form, her spirit, and the love she poured into others will continue to live on.
